TANFARM Posted May 18, 2021 Share Posted May 18, 2021 I’ve been running a well used 650 for 9 mm for quite awhile......running my last batch of 9 mm the powder drop assembly seems to be dropping down with a “ thud”......it’s not a smooth action up and down as usual! Any thoughts.....putting off Calling Dillon because they are still swamped Thanks in advance......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
m700 Posted May 18, 2021 Share Posted May 18, 2021 The brass colored piece on the side needs to be adjusted. Take it apart/clean it. If you choose to you can add dry lube to this part or at least where it makes contact. If you watch it that is the part that sticks then drops when it finally comes free. Dont use liquid lube on the powder assembly parts the powder will stick to it.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
